Open Positions
Category Editor: Research and compile architecture/design projects. Write and edit articles. Find visual sources and perform fact-checks. Proficiency in English and basic WordPress knowledge is required.
Event Guide / Newsletter Editor: Compile global design events and exhibitions. Write engaging descriptions. Curate newsletter content.
Social Media Editor :Create content for Instagram/LinkedIn. Produce Reels and Stories. Edit visuals and engage with the community. Social media experience and video editing skills are required.
Partnerships/Awards Editor: Research design awards coverage. Coordinate partnerships. Write sponsored content.
Visual Editor :Select stunning project visuals, manage the visual archive using Adobe Bridge workflow, coordinate with photographers and architects for high-resolution assets. Exceptional visual curation skills, technical ability in composition and lighting are required.
